🍵 1. Masala Sandwich


Ingredients :

Bread slices

Butter

Chopped onion, tomato, cucumber

Green chutney & chaat masala

Steps:
  1. 1. Spread butter & chutney on bread
2. Add sliced veggies and sprinkle chaat masala.
3. Toast till golden
4.💡 Perfect with evening tea or coffee!

🍟 2. Aloo Tikki (Potato Cutlet)


Ingredients:

Boiled potatoes

Salt, red chili, garam masala

Bread crumbs & oil
Steps : 
1. Mash potatoes, mix spices.


2. Make small tikkis, coat with crumbs.


3. Shallow fry till crispy.


🔥 Serve with ketchup or green chutney!

🌮 3. Paneer Pakoda


Ingredients:

Paneer cubes

Besan (gram flour)

Salt, turmeric, chili powder

Oil for frying
Steps:
1. Make thick batter with besan & spices.


2. Dip paneer cubes, deep fry till golden brown.



😋 Crispy outside, soft inside!
🍜 4. Instant Maggi Masala Balls


Ingredients:

Cooked Maggi noodles

Cornflour

Spices (salt, chili, oregano)
Steps:

1. Mix Maggi with cornflour and spices.


2. Make small balls & shallow fry.



🤩 Fun snack for kids!

🍪 5. Sweet Bread Rolls


Ingredients:


Bread

Sugar & milk

Oil or ghee
Steps :


1. Dip bread in milk, fill with sugar.


2. Roll, fry till golden, and sprinkle sugar on top.

      ✨ Tastes just like mini gulab jamuns!
